一、什么是不规则裁切图片?

不规则裁切图片,指的是把图片按照一定的规则进行裁剪,形成不规则的形状,这种裁切技术可以把一张普通的图片变成非常有趣的形状,有助于突出图片的主题,提高图片的表现力。

二、C# 实现不规则裁切图片

C# 实现不规则裁切图片,需要用到 GDI+(Graphics Device Interface)技术,GDI+ 是一种软件编程接口,可以用来显示文本和图形,GDI+ 提供了一系列的函数,可以用来实现不规则裁切图片。

三、C# 实现不规则裁切图片的步骤

1、首先,需要准备一张要裁切的图片;

2、然后,使用 Graphics 类的 FromImage 方法,将图片转换成 Graphics 对象;

Graphics g = Graphics.FromImage(image);
C#

3、接着,使用 Graphics 类的 DrawPath 方法,绘制不规则的图形;

g.DrawPath(pen, path);
C#

4、最后,使用 Graphics 类的 DrawImage 方法,将不规则的图形裁切出来;

g.DrawImage(image, rect, rect, GraphicsUnit.Pixel);
C#